11 SWAN STREET, MANCHESTER
Reg Number: 08663099
Date of Inc: January 01, 1970
17 SWAN STREET, MANCHESTER
Reg Number: 06657061
Teletech, Manchester
Reg Number: 13243966
Date of Inc: March 04, 2021
19 SWAN STREET, MANCHESTER
Reg Number: 13238158
Date of Inc: February 03, 2021
7-9 SWAN STREET, LANCASHIRE
Reg Number: 05715831
Reg Number: 05781627
SWAN BUILDINGS, MANCHESTER
Reg Number: 14691793
19 Swan Street, Manchester
Reg Number: 06760888
Date of Inc: November 28, 2008